Web2. Mountain Bluebird. The male Mountain Bluebird is one of the brightest blue-colored birds in western North America, with a sky blue front and bright cerulean back. Females in comparison are drab, with a mostly pale gray body with only touches of blue. This omnivorous bird eats berries, insects, and caterpillars. WebNov 10, 2024 · The colors on a bird’s feathers come from pigment cells that produce melanin. Melanin is a dark brown to the black pigment that colors hair, skin, and eyes. The amount of melanin in the pigment cells can vary, which is why some birds have lighter-colored feathers than others. WebApr 2, 2015 · Each of these conditions can affect how a bird behaves — and could be linked to the hue of its feathers. When male and female birds are the same color, natural selection likely caused them to evolve plumage of same hue, the new study concludes. “Natural selection determines the color in general,” Dunn says.
